Burnet (Gilbert). Some Letters, Containing an Account of what seemed most Remarkable in Travelling through Switzerland, Italy, some parts of Germany, &c. In the Years 1685 and 1686, 2nd edition, corrected and altered in some places by the author, Rotterdam: Printed for Abraham Acher, 1687, [xxii],336pp., bound withThree Letters concerning the Present State of Italy, written in the Year 1687. I. Relating to the Affair of Molinos, and the Quietists. II. Relating to the Inquisition, and the State of Religion. III. Relating to the Policy and Interest of some of the States of Italy, [London?], 1688, [xvi],191pp., with errata to verso of final leaf, occasional minor marks and light soiling, all edges gilt, attractive late 18th or early 19th century gilt-decorated red full morocco, lightly rubbed, 8vo, together with:Pascal (Blaise). Pensées de Mr. Pascal sur la Religion, et sur quelques autres sujets, qui ont esté trouvées apres sa mort parmy ses paperes, Amsterdam: Abraham Wolfganck, suivant la copie imprimée a Paris 1677, old ownership insription to title, a few marks, later calf, backstrip deficient, 12mo, plus[Davies, John]. Reflections upon Monsieur Des Cartes's Discourse of a Method for the Well-guiding of Reason, and Discovery of Truth in the Sciences. Written by a private Pen in French, and Translated out of the Original Manuscript, by J. D., London: Printed and are to be sold by Peter Parker, 1679, [14 (of 16)], 93pp., lacking A2(?), some marks and light soiling, title and final leaf relined, late 19th or early 20th century boards, 12mo, and other 17th century works, with defects including Hugh Latimer, [Frutefull Sermons], circa 1578, lacking title (text begins on A1 'to the Right Honourable the Lady Katherine, Dutches of Suffolke), final leaf with some repairs, old calf, worn with covers detached, small 4to, Charles Hoole, The Common Accidence Examined and Explained by short questions and answers according to the very words of the book. Conducing very much to the ease of the teacher, and the benefit of the learner, 1690 (lacking leaf of index at end), The Divine Banquet, or Sacramental Devotions, 1716, and the first volume of a two-volume bible published by Thomas Basket, 1756 (in contemporary binding), the last three works 12moQTY: (7)NOTE:Provenance: From the library of Alan Clutton-Brock (1904-1976), thence by descent.
